
發布
注冊
/
登錄journal的案例
二十五、FLUENT Journal文件的使用
<p><strong>1.說明</strong></p><p>FLUENT 使用Journal文件可以自動化的完成一系列操作,如當某個case文件需要重復的改變一些變量進行計算時,人為的操作改變變量,會耗費許多的精力,而通過journal文件可以比較快速的達到這樣的目的。</p><p><br></p><p><strong>2.Journal文件分類</strong></p><p>Journal文件分為兩種,第一種為GUI(圖形用戶界面) Journal文件,第二種為TUI Journal文件(文本用戶界面)。兩者能夠完成相同的操作,但其基本代碼及編寫方法相差卻很大。各有優缺點。</p><p><br></p><p><strong>3.GUI Journal文件</strong></p><p>GUI(圖形用戶界面) Journal文件:顧名思義,通過圖形界面來編寫該文件,編寫過程非常簡單,但代碼比較復雜。</p><p><br></p><p>編寫過程:</p><p><br></p><p> 1. 打開fluent后,File-Write-Start Journal</p><p> <img src="https://mmbiz.qpic.cn/mmbiz_png/8tJMdLVYZyic6bKll6Olj0baR0qqItUZYRxlnGJq5QAOes5FBnX6Og9YEQnwIoHPZJv9SclpNywe6D9bLckiam7A/640?wx_fmt=png"> </p><p><br></p><p> 2. 彈出對話框,輸入journal名稱即可,然后會在當前的文件夾中生成一個.jou文件。
展開 Fluent journal的簡單應用
在使用fluent的時候常常會遇到很多例子需要大量的重復性勞動,比如將下面的圓柱作若干切片,然后統計每個面上的速度或者其他量的大小,這類問題通常來說可以采用journal進行處理,整個流程會方便很多。對于大量重復的計算邊界輸入或者計算結果提取,考慮參數化會方便一些。
Fluent中并不需要專門去學習這個journal,完全可以讓fluent自己生成journal然后進行修改。具體操作過程如下首先在fluent中開始記錄一個journal,之后會提示將這個journal文件保存為什么名字和存儲的位置,這個都隨意,確定好就可以開始在fluent中進行切片操作了。
通過上訴的步驟完成切片之后,就可以停止journal了,這個時候注意要記住保存好journal的位置,后續要對journal進行修改。
用記事本打開剛剛存儲的文件,得到如圖所示的一些行,刪除一些不必要的東西,具體需要刪除什么你一看就懂了,并把需要重復的命令復制多行修改切好的片的名字,如下圖所示,然后保存,得到內容如下所示。
這個時候繼續進入到fluent軟件中,打開創建切片的窗口,選擇好需要切割的計算區域,然后把上面做好的journal導入,fluent就會自動的完成對應的切片操作。
據圖的導入過程如下,整個導入過程非常快,相比于手動的且給要方便不少。
自動就完成了切片任務了,如果有大量的需要分割的話或者分割不等距的話這么簡單復制并修改其中的內容需要操作的量也是非常可觀的,這個時候就可以導入到excel,簡單的編輯之后再做成journal導入Fluent中進行計算。
展開 Controllable high speed journal bearings
Controllable high speed journal bearings, lubricated with electro-rheological fluids. An analytical and experimental approach
Controllable high speed journal bearings, lubricated with electro-rheological fluids. An analytical
[問題討論]Gambit教程—運行日志文件(.jou文件)
當用戶從File命令菜單中選擇了Run Journal窗口,GAMBIT將打開Run Journal窗口。Run Journal窗口使用戶可以執行日志文件中包含的命令。Run Journal窗口允許用戶運行日志文件,包括當前(臨時)的日志文件,以前進程保存的日志文件和通過文本編輯在GAMBIT程序外部生成的日志文件。當用戶運行日志文件時,將執行文件中的命令,就像是通過命令行輸入的命令一樣。
注意(1):GAMBIT允許用戶在日志文件中使用IF塊和DO循環。
注意(2):在Run Journal操作過程中,用戶可以在任何時刻暫停日志文件的執行。當文件暫停時,GAMBIT允許用戶通過命令行執行命令或者通過Run Journal窗口打開和運行其他日志文件。在后進先出原則下保持一個打開和執行日志文件的堆棧。
二、日志文件的運行模式
用戶可以在一下兩種模式的任意一種之下運行日志文件:
—Run
—Edit/Run
1、Run模式
當用戶在Run模式下運行一個日志文件時,GAMBIT從文件的頂部開始按照次序自動執行日志文件中的所有命令。
2、Edit/Run模式
當用戶在Edit/Run模式下運行日志文件時,GAMBIT將打Edit/Run Journal開窗口。Edit/Run Journal窗口使用戶可以編輯和運行整個日志文件也可以指定其中的一部分。
3、使用Run Journal窗口
Run Journal窗口(如下圖)允許用戶運行一個現有的日志文件。要打開Run Journal窗口,只要從主菜單條的File菜單中選擇Run Journal窗口即可。
展開 
#強大的neper-三維voronoi泰森多邊形建立#
Delobelle,
Sensitivity of the residual topography to single crystal plasticity parameters in Berkovich nanoindentation on FCC nickel, International Journal of Plasticity
, vol. 77, pp. 118-140, 2016.
J.V. Beeck, F. Maresca, T.W.J. de Geus, P.J.G. Schreurs and M.G.D. Geers,
Predicting deformation-induced polymer-steel interface roughening and failure, European Journal of Mechanics / A Solids
, vol. 55, pp. 1-11, 2016.
2015
Quey, J.H. Driver and P.R. Dawson.
Intra-grain orientation distributions in hot-deformed aluminium: Orientation dependence and relation to deformation mechanisms, Journal of the Mechanics and Physics of Solids
, vol. 84, pp. 506-527, 2015.
Zhang, Z.H. Chen and C.F.
展開 Fluent 批處理技巧
基本原理是使用fluent的
journal文件,你要寫一個journal文件,命名為1.journal
在fluent 的file/write/start journal,選擇文件名1.journal后,fluent就還是記錄你的
操作到1.jouranl中,你操作完成后,file/write/stop journal,用記事本打開看看就知道
了。
來一個我寫好的journal文件,其作用是讀取已有的case and data,計算,保存計算結果。
內容如下:
(cx-gui-do cx-activate-item "MenuBar*ReadSubMenu*Case & Data...")
(cx-gui-do cx-set-text-entry "Select File*Text" "lzzmn.cas")
(cx-gui-do cx-activate-item "Select File*OK")
(cx-gui-do cx-activate-item "MenuBar*SolveMenu*Iterate...")
(cx-gui-do cx-set-integer-entry
"Iterate*Table1*Frame2(Iteration)*Table2(Iteration)*IntegerEntry1(Number of
Iterations)" 2000)
(cx-gui-do cx-activate-item "MenuBar*SolveMenu*Iterate...")
(cx-gui-do cx-activate-item "Iterate*PanelButtons*PushButton1(OK)")
(cx-gui-do cx-activate-item "MenuBar*WriteSubMenu*Case & Data...")
展開 機械式穩定土墻MSEW(Mechanically Stabilized Earth Retaining Walls)數據集
Journal of Geotechnical and Geoenvironmental Engineering 138(3): 241-251.
[7] Kim, D. and R. Salgado (2012). "Load and Resistance Factors for Internal Stability Checks of Mechanically Stabilized Earth Walls." Journal of Geotechnical and Geoenvironmental Engineering 138(8): 910-921.
[8] Stuedlein, A., et al. (2012). "Assessment of Reinforcement Strains in Very Tall Mechanically Stabilized Earth Walls." Journal of Geotechnical and Geoenvironmental Engineering 138(3): 345-356.
展開 Fluent實現大量氣泡的隨機分布案例
為了實現在一段管道中大量初始氣泡的隨機分布(如圖1所示),通過Fluent的journal文件結合matlab程序實現。
圖1 管道示意圖
2、實現思路及過程
Fluent的journal文件可以實現對Fluent的自動操作,一行journal文件代碼對應Fluent中一個操作步驟。通常情況下,在初始化過程中,在region中指定氣泡坐標和大小(半徑),可以通過一次Patch完成一個初始氣泡,但如果要實現上百個氣泡的隨機分布則工作量太大(如圖2-3)。
圖2 Region操作
圖3 Patch操作
為了實現大量隨機分布,通過matlab的rand或者randn函數隨機生成指定范圍內氣泡的位置(X,Y,Z)和半徑r,rand函數實現比較均勻的隨機分布,randn則實現符合正態分布規律的隨機分布(如圖4)。
圖4 Matlab程序實現300個氣泡位置和大小的隨機
之后通過for循環,將每一個氣泡的坐標和大小導入到一次region和patch操縱對應的journal文件代碼中。生成300段journal文件代碼,matlab保存為txt文件,之后將文件后綴名字改為.jou,則可以導入Fluent中,生成所有的氣泡。
展開 韓清龍教授講座手稿整理
Must Be Within the Main Scope of the Journal Submitted(必須在期刊提交的最佳時間提交你的論文)
l Article outside of the journal scope may not receive fair and objective review
在雜志審稿期之外發表的論文,可能不會得到公正、客觀的回復
l Remember that the prime source of reviewers are authors of previously published articles in the journal submitted
記住,雜志的主要投稿人是以前在這個雜志發表過論文的作者
l If article is publish in wrong journal it may left unnoticed
如果文章被發表在不合適的雜志上,這篇文章可能不會怎么引人注意
7. Well Select References(合理的選擇參考文獻)
l Have to follow current references (article without recent references-couple years are automatically rejected)
必須跟隨當今的參考文獻(如果你的文章沒有應用足夠的最近年份的參考文獻,那可能會直接被自動駁回)
l Avoid second-sited references
避免重復引用參考文獻
l Not too many self-cited references
不要有太多自引的參考文獻
展開 寧波材料所在自抗凝透析器研究方面取得系列進展
可實現海綿狀孔/指狀孔等梯度結構有效調控(Journal of Membrane Science 2015, 478, 96-104),并且針對聚乳酸微孔膜結晶度低和耐熱性差的問題,發展了界面交聯誘導結晶的方法,提高了微孔膜的結晶度及耐熱溫度(Journal of Membrane Science 2016, 513, 166-176,ACS Biomaterials Science & Engineering 2016, 2 , 2207–2216)。
2)膜表面抗凝分子修飾:通過膜表面多巴胺固定肝素(Journal of Membrane Science 2014, 452, 390-399)、膜表面兩性離子化(Journal of Membrane Science 2015, 475, 469-479)、表面PEG化(ACS Applied Materials & Interfaces 2015, 7, 17748-17755)、膜表面水蛭素修飾(Journal of Membrane Science 2017, 523, 505-514)改善聚乳酸微孔膜的親水性及血液相容性,揭示了膜表面親水抗蛋白吸附和類肝素抗凝分子抑制凝血瀑布效應的機理。
3)自抗凝透析器:中空纖維透析器內含超過1萬根中空纖維膜,其內徑通常小于200微米,在微米級的限域通道內實現親水和抗凝分子的修飾具有非常大的挑戰性。目前臨床用的聚砜和聚醚砜類透析器通常采用在相轉化過程中共混高分子量聚乙烯吡絡烷酮(PVP)實現其親水抗凝修飾,但是PVP與聚砜或聚醚砜存在相容性差異,通常易在膜表面析出形成“布丁”粒子,在透析過程中形成掛血點,并容易進入血液當中。
展開 阿拉斯加發生M6.1級地震(Alaska arthquake)
Journal of Geotechnical and Geoenvironmental Engineering 136(10): 1334-1346.
[7] Crawford, C. B., et al. (1994). "The influence of lateral spreading on settlements beneath a fill." Canadian Geotechnical Journal 31(2): 145-150.

fluent批量處理——模型參數的設置
那就是采用fluent的journal文件。
首先打開fluent軟件,在file/write/start journal,見下圖:
選擇保存文件名*.journal后(看你自己怎么設置文件名),我一般按照這一組的類型來命名;
這樣, journal文件就開始記錄你以后的每一步操作。
按照原先設置模型參數一樣,一步步來就是了。
等你操作完成后,原先的”start journal“現在已經是”stop journal“,所以你只需要選擇”stop journal“就可以了。
此時,用寫字板打開看看就可以看到如下的一些記錄命令。
(cx-gui-do cx-activate-item "MenuBar*ReadSubMenu*Case...")
(cx-gui-do cx-activate-item "Warning*OK")
(cx-gui-do cx-set-text-entry "Select File*Text" "fluent.msh")
(cx-gui-do cx-activate-item "Select File*OK")
(cx-gui-do cx-activate-item "MenuBar*GridMenu*Check")
(cx-gui-do cx-activate-item "MenuBar*GridMenu*Smooth/Swap...")
展開 彭銳笨貓的若干可靠性論文, 希望對大家有用
., Optimal defenseof single object with imperfect false targets, Journal of the OperationalResearch Society, 62(1), 134-141, 2011.
3. Peng, R., Xie, M., Ng, S.H., Levitin, G., Elementmaintenance and allocation for linear consecutively connected systems, IIETransactions, 44(11), 964-973, 2012.
4. Peng, R., Mo, H. D., Xie, M., Levitin, G., 2013. Optimalstructure of multi-state systems with multi-fault coverage. ReliabilityEngineering and System Safety 119,18-25.
5. Peng, R., Li, Y.F., Zhang, J.G., Li, X., 2015. Arisk-reduction approach for optimal software release time determination withthe delay incurred cost. International Journal of Systems Science 46 (9),1628-1637.
6. Peng, R., Zhai, Q.Q., Xing, L.D., Yang, J., 2014.
展開 貴州大學謝蘭教授團隊:高導熱的高性能電磁屏蔽材料
在Chemical Engineering Journal、Composites Part B、Journal of Materials Chemistry A、Industrial & Engineering Chemistry Research等國際期刊發表論文20余篇,總影響因子超過200,SCI他引300余次。目前主持國家科學基金1項,省級項目4項,進賬經費超過100萬。
劉迅成, 1989年出生,工學博士,碩士生導師,特聘教授。美國加州大學伯克利分校勞倫斯伯克利國家實驗室—華南理工大學聯合培養博士。曾任職于成都京東方光電科技有限公司,擔任高級工程師.現任貴州大學特聘教授,一流學科特區引進人才,碩士研究生導師,從事有機半導體材料的設計合成及其在場效應晶體管和柔性電子上面的應用。發表SCI學術論文15篇,影響因子總和大于140。以第一作者發表七篇國際高水平SCI論文,包括Journal of the American Chemical Society、Advanced Functional Materials等,影響因子總和大于70。
展開 13篇近代數值分析經典文獻
Kahan, "Calculating the singular values and pseudo-inverse
of a matrix," SIAM Journal on Numerical Analysis 2 (1965), 205-224.
8. A. Brandt, "Multi-level adaptive solutions to boundary-value problems,"
Mathematics of Computation 31 (1977), 333-390.
9. Magnus R. Hestenes and Eduard Stiefel, "Methods of conjugate gradients for
solving linear systems," Journal of Research of the National Bureau of
Standards 49 (1952), 409-436.
10. R. Fletcher and M. J. D. Powell, "A rapidly convergent descent method for
minimization," Computer Journal 6 (1963), 163-168.
11. G. Wanner, E. Hairer and S. P. Norsett, "Order stars and stability
theorems," BIT 18 (1974), 475-489.
12. N.
展開